package cmd
import (
"context"
"fmt"
"time"
"github.com/fatih/color"
"github.com/minio/cli"
json "github.com/minio/colorjson"
"github.com/minio/madmin-go"
"github.com/minio/mc/pkg/probe"
"github.com/minio/pkg/console"
)
var adminServiceRestartCmd = cli.Command{
Name: "restart",
Usage: "restart a MinIO cluster",
Action: mainAdminServiceRestart,
OnUsageError: onUsageError,
Before: setGlobalsFromContext,
Flags: globalFlags,
CustomHelpTemplate: `NAME:
{{.HelpName}} - {{.Usage}}
USAGE:
{{.HelpName}} TARGET
FLAGS:
{{range .VisibleFlags}}{{.}}
{{end}}
EXAMPLES:
1. Restart MinIO server represented by its alias 'play'.
{{.Prompt}} {{.HelpName}} play/
`,
}
// serviceRestartCommand is container for service restart command success and failure messages.
type serviceRestartCommand struct {
Status string `json:"status"`
ServerURL string `json:"serverURL"`
}
// String colorized service restart command message.
func (s serviceRestartCommand) String() string {
return console.Colorize("ServiceRestart", "Restart command successfully sent to `"+s.ServerURL+"`. Type Ctrl-C to quit or wait to follow the status of the restart process.")
}
// JSON jsonified service restart command message.
func (s serviceRestartCommand) JSON() string {
serviceRestartJSONBytes, e := json.MarshalIndent(s, "", " ")
fatalIf(probe.NewError(e), "Unable to marshal into JSON.")
return string(serviceRestartJSONBytes)
}
// serviceRestartMessage is container for service restart success and failure messages.
type serviceRestartMessage struct {
Status string `json:"status"`
ServerURL string `json:"serverURL"`
TimeTaken time.Duration `json:"timeTaken"`
Err error `json:"error,omitempty"`
}
// String colorized service restart message.
func (s serviceRestartMessage) String() string {
if s.Err == nil {
return console.Colorize("ServiceRestart", fmt.Sprintf("\nRestarted `%s` successfully in %s", s.ServerURL, timeDurationToHumanizedDuration(s.TimeTaken).StringShort()))
}
return console.Colorize("FailedServiceRestart", "Failed to restart `"+s.ServerURL+"`. error: "+s.Err.Error())
}
// JSON jsonified service restart message.
func (s serviceRestartMessage) JSON() string {
serviceRestartJSONBytes, e := json.MarshalIndent(s, "", " ")
fatalIf(probe.NewError(e), "Unable to marshal into JSON.")
return string(serviceRestartJSONBytes)
}
// checkAdminServiceRestartSyntax - validate all the passed arguments
func checkAdminServiceRestartSyntax(ctx *cli.Context) {
if len(ctx.Args()) != 1 {
showCommandHelpAndExit(ctx, 1) // last argument is exit code
}
}
func mainAdminServiceRestart(ctx *cli.Context) error {
// Validate serivce restart syntax.
checkAdminServiceRestartSyntax(ctx)
ctxt, cancel := context.WithCancel(globalContext)
defer cancel()
// Set color.
console.SetColor("ServiceOffline", color.New(color.FgRed, color.Bold))
console.SetColor("ServiceInitializing", color.New(color.FgYellow, color.Bold))
console.SetColor("ServiceRestart", color.New(color.FgGreen, color.Bold))
console.SetColor("FailedServiceRestart", color.New(color.FgRed, color.Bold))
// Get the alias parameter from cli
args := ctx.Args()
aliasedURL := args.Get(0)
client, err := newAdminClient(aliasedURL)
fatalIf(err, "Unable to initialize admin connection.")
// Restart the specified MinIO server
fatalIf(probe.NewError(client.ServiceRestart(ctxt)), "Unable to restart the server.")
// Success..
printMsg(serviceRestartCommand{Status: "success", ServerURL: aliasedURL})
// Start pinging the service until it is ready
anonClient, err := newAnonymousClient(aliasedURL)
fatalIf(err.Trace(aliasedURL), "Could not ping `"+aliasedURL+"`.")
coloring := color.New(color.FgRed)
mark := "..."
// Print restart progress
printProgress := func() {
if !globalQuiet && !globalJSON {
coloring.Printf(mark)
}
}
printProgress()
mark = "."
timer := time.NewTimer(time.Second)
defer timer.Stop()
t := time.Now()
for {
select {
case <-ctxt.Done():
return ctxt.Err()
case <-timer.C:
healthCtx, healthCancel := context.WithTimeout(ctxt, 3*time.Second)
// Fetch the health status of the specified MinIO server
healthResult, healthErr := anonClient.Healthy(healthCtx, madmin.HealthOpts{})
healthCancel()
switch {
case healthErr == nil && healthResult.Healthy:
printMsg(serviceRestartMessage{
Status: "success",
ServerURL: aliasedURL,
TimeTaken: time.Since(t),
})
return nil
case healthErr == nil && !healthResult.Healthy:
coloring = color.New(color.FgYellow)
mark = "!"
fallthrough
default:
printProgress()
}
timer.Reset(time.Second)
}
}
}
